Art speaks when words fail. The Art Therapy program introduces students to a human service profession that focuses on the use of art as an alternative means of expression. Students learn how art therapists use their skills as artists and clinicians to guide the individual in creative exploration and expression. Through the creative process, there can be a sense of release, freedom, self-awareness, and personal growth. Lectures, field experience, and experiential learning projects help students understand the effectiveness of the profession with diverse populations and techniques.

Course Requirement Definitions:
Elective Requirement: Additional courses necessary to earn enough credits for a degree outside of Major and STAGE requirements.
First Year Seminar (FYS): Introductory course to the academic experience, emphasizing the skills necessary for academic success.
Major Requirement: Courses are core to this major and are subject matter-specific.
Stage Requirement: Courses are part of our STAGE General Education program, and must be taken to earn a degree. Learn more here>
